Biopolitics, biolaw, and bioethics are ubiquitous buzzwords associated with a field of scientific development that has accelerated rapidly in recent years. At a symposium titled "Globalization of Biopolitics, Biolaw, and Bioethics? Life at Its Beginning and End" at Martin Luther University Halle-Wittenberg, scholars engaged in interdisciplinary and international discourse on current issues. The topics range from stem cell and embryo research to preimplantation and prenatal diagnostics, germline therapy, therapeutic and reproductive cloning, as well as questions related to brain research, palliative care, and euthanasia.
